Job Description
The Development Director provides leadership in financial development efforts for assigned regions to advance the YMCA's mission. This individual will support the design and implementation of a comprehensive development and engagement program.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in related field required. Master’s degree preferred.
- A minimum of three (3) years’ experience in fundraising, marketing, planning and/or prospecting.
- Demonstrated strong persuasive written and verbal communication skills and display excellent organizational skills.
- Ability to engage others in support of the mission; establish strong collaborative relationships and work with others, including all levels of executives and volunteers, in a cooperative and effective manner.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ities and projects, adhering to deadlines and meet goals.
Essential Functions
- Manage an assigned personal portfolio of gifts using Moves Management strategies to include identification, qualification, cultivation, solicitation, negotiation and stewardship.
- Develop a personalized communications plan for assigned donors. This should include regular touch points, invitations to tour Y programs/facilities, regular meetings, etc.
- Develop and lead an assigned portfolio of high-level special projects including but not limited to:
- capital and comprehensive campaigns.
- planned giving, sponsorship support.
- special events.
- data analysis.
- donor drives.
- strategic partnership opportunities.
- Develop strategies and support efforts surrounding Fundraising at the branch level including but not limited to:
- Lead process for development and implementation of Annual Campaign plan.
- Develop comprehensive timeline with benchmarks.
- Develop Campaign collateral.
- Provide training for branch-level staff and volunteers.
- Create a strategy for volunteer recruitment and engagement through the Campaign in conjunction with Community Executives.
- Implement a 12-month communication plan for donors.
- Provide support for Community Executives managing Major Gift portfolios and branch campaigns, to include tools, training and troubleshooting. Responsible for prospecting and pipeline development in assigned regions for new funding sources.
- Responsible for coaching a fundraising volunteer cohort, including branch advisory boards, by implementing training sessions around cause and giving.
